2023 (SENIOR)
Played 29 games with 14 starts in his only season at ULM, slashing .322/.406/.508 with 19 hits, five doubles, two home runs, 13 RBIs, 12 runs scored and eight walks … Had five multi-hit games and four multi-RBI games … Had a late season charge, playing in 12 consecutive games with 10 starts from April 22 to May 13, slashing .457/.535/.771 with 16 hits, five doubles, two home runs, 13 RBIs, nine runs scored and six walks … Collected two RBIs while picking up a double vs. Southern Miss (5/12/23) … Picked up three hits, including a double, with a walk and a run scored vs. Ragin' Cajuns (5/6/23) … Continued his late-season surge with two hits, including a double, with three RBIs, three runs scored and a walk vs. Alcorn (5/3/23) … Picked up two hits with a run scored in the series finale at Georgia Southern (4/30/23) … Added two hits with two RBIs and a run scored vs. Stephen F. Austin (4/25/23) … Made his fifth start of the season, going 3-for-3 with four RBIs and a run scored, hitting a 2-run home run and a 2-RBI double, with two walks at Arkansas State (4/23/23) … Came off the bench to hit his first home run as a Warhawk, a solo blast, at Arkansas State (4/22/23) … Picked up a pinch-hit single vs. South Alabama (4/16/23) … Had his first hit as a Warhawk, going 1-for-3 with a run scored vs. Bradley (2/18/23) … Made his ULM debut with a start in right field vs. Bradley (2/17/23).

LSU EUNICE
Played three seasons at LSU Eunice, wrapping up his time as a Bengal as a First-Team NJCAA All-American, helping LSUE to a NJCAA-record seventh National Championship in 2021 … Left LSUE in the Top 10 in several single-season categories, including third in slugging percentage (.695, 2021), fourth (.528, 2021) and eighth (.524, 2019) in on-base percentage, fifth in walks (47, 2019) and eighth in home runs (11, 2021) … As a second-year sophomore in 2021, was also named First-Team All-Louisiana by the Louisiana Sports Writers Association and Region 23 All-Regional Team after playing in 57 games, slashing .356/.518/.669 with 13 doubles, two triples, 11 home runs, 53 RBIs, 63 runs scored, 43 walks and nine stolen bases … Had 15 multi-hit games and 14 multi-RBI games … Hit safely in all six games at the NJCAA Division II World Series … In the third-and-final game of the NJCAA Championship series, went 2-for-5 with a double and an RBI in LSUE’s 5-4 title-clinching win over Western Oklahoma State (6/5/21) … Had two hits with a triple and three RBIs against Phoenix in the opening round of the NJCAA Division II World Series (5/30/21) … Hit his final home run of the season, picking up two RBIs vs. Nunez-1 (4/18/21) … Went 2-for-2 with a double, home run, four RBIs and two runs scored vs. Baton Rouge-2 (4/7/21) … Picked up five consecutive multi-hit games from March 25 to March 31, going 13-for-18 (.722) with four doubles, one home run, seven RBIs, seven runs scored and two walks … Had three hits with a double, four RBIs and three runs scored at Delgado-1 (3/31/21) … Tallied three hits with a pair of doubles and two RBIs vs. Nunez-2 (3/27/21) … Three hits with a solo home run and two runs scored vs. Nunez-2 (3/25/21) … Monster game with four hits, including three home runs and a double, with six RBIs and four runs scored at National Park-2 (3/21/21) … Had two hits, a double and a home run, with four RBIs, two runs scored and three walks at National Park (3/20/21) … Picked up two hits, a double and a home run, with four RBIs, two runs scored and a walk vs. LSU-Alexandria (2/6/21) … Hit his first home run of the season with two RBIs vs. National Park (2/5/21) … As a first-year sophomore in 2020, was hitting .421 with a team-high seven doubles through 18 games before the season was cut short due to the COVID-19 pandemic … As a freshman in 2019, played in 56 games, slashing .371/.524/.565 with 63 hits, 16 doubles, four triples, three home runs, 45 RBIs, 60 runs scored, 47 walks and 12 stolen bases … Had 17 multi-hit games and nine multi-RBI games … Had three hits with an RBI vs. Mississippi Gulf Coast (5/17/19) … Tallied four hits with a double, four RBIs and three runs scored at East Texas Baptist-1 (4/24/19) … Went 2-for-2 with a triple, five RBIs, three runs scored and two walks vs. Baton Rouge (4/14/19) … Picked up two hits with a triple, three RBIs, three runs scored and a walk at Tyler (4/6/19) … Two hits, with a double, and two RBIs vs. Coastal Bend-1 (3/22/19) … Chipped in three hits, including a double, with four RBIs and two runs scored at Baton Rouge (3/17/19) … Collected two hits, including a home run, with four RBIs and two runs scored vs. Kellogg-1 (2/24/19) … Had two hits, including a home run, with two RBIs and three runs scored at Coastal Bend-1 (2/15/19) … Clubbed his first collegiate home run with two RBIs and a run scored vs. St. Louis (2/9/19) … Had his first multi-hit game with three hits, a double and two triples, with two RBIs and two runs scored vs. Paris (2/1/19).

STERLINGTON HS
Four-year varsity letterwinner and a team captain for the Sterlington Panthers, helping his team to a Class 2A State Championship before graduating in 2018 … As a senior, was named to the Class 3A All-State Team by the Louisiana Sports Writers Association and Louisiana Baseball Coaches Association, named Class 3A All-State Hitter of the Year by the LBCA, named to the LBCA Composite All-State Team, named to the LBCA All-Region Team in Region 2, named First-Team All-NELA, All-Parish and All-District, named district MVP and All-Parish Player of the Year as the Panthers went 35-4 and won a Class 3A District Championship … As a junior, was named to the Class 2A All-State Team by the LSWA and LBCA, First-Team All-NELA and All-District and Second-Team All-Parish … As a sophomore, was named honorable mention Class 2A All-State by the LSWA, First-Team All-District, All-NELA and All-Parish … As a freshman, was named First-Team All-District … earned a varsity letter in football as a fullback in 2016 … listed on honor roll all four years of high school.
